About 14 Highfields
14 Highfields is a three-bedroom detached house in Crowle, Scunthorpe, Scunthorpe (DN17 4NP). It has a recorded floor area of 113 m² (around 1216 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1996-2002 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(January 2020) shows a C (score 72). When first surveyed in September 2009 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, lighting went from Poor to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 84). Other recorded features include a conservatory.
Across 2001–2020, sale prices on this property compounded at 6.7%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£339,000 is 13.8%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£245/sq ft) was about 38.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£298,000 in September 2020.
